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ask Her Majesty's Government what steps they are taking to improve life expectancy for women in the UK.


Answered by
Lord Bethell Portrait
Lord Bethell
This question was answered on 10th March 2020

The Government wants everyone to have the same opportunity to have a long, healthy life, whoever they are, wherever they live and whatever their background.

The best way to improve life expectancy is to prevent health problems from arising in the first place. The Prevention Green Paper published last year set out plans to shift the focus from cure to prevention and the NHS Long Term Plan makes clear commitments to strengthen the National Health Service’s contribution to prevention and health inequalities.
